How to Craft Your Perfect Weekly Menu Plan

Creating a menu plan doesn’t have to be complicated or rigid. It’s a flexible framework designed to support your lifestyle. Here’s a simple, step-by-step guide to help you get started and make the most of your planning efforts.

Step 1: Inventory Your Pantry, Fridge, and Freezer

Before you even think about new recipes, take stock of what you already have. Open your pantry, peek into your fridge, and explore your freezer. What ingredients are nearing their expiration date? What staples do you have in abundance? Building meals around existing ingredients is the ultimate money-saving and waste-reducing strategy. This foundational step ensures you utilize what you’ve already purchased.

Step 2: Browse Sales and Circulars

Once you know what you have, check your local grocery store flyers or online apps for weekly sales. Are chicken breasts on sale? Is there a special on seasonal vegetables? Incorporating sale items into your plan can lead to significant savings. This step allows you to optimize your budget by pairing your existing ingredients with discounted items.

Step 3: Choose Your Recipes Wisely

Now for the fun part: selecting your meals! Aim for a balance of quick weeknight dinners and perhaps one or two more involved recipes for days when you have more time. Consider your family’s preferences, dietary needs, and how much time you realistically have for cooking each day.

  • Incorporate New Flavors: To keep mealtime exciting, try to add at least one new recipe to your menu each week. This encourages your family to explore different cuisines and expands your culinary repertoire without overwhelming you.
  • Utilize Kitchen Appliances: Embrace the convenience of modern kitchen gadgets. Our sample menu features a variety of meals perfect for the slow cooker, Instant Pot, and air fryer, alongside traditional and grilled dishes. These appliances are fantastic for saving time and simplifying complex recipes.
  • Flexibility is Key: Don’t feel pressured to stick to a rigid theme. A mix of protein sources, cooking methods, and flavor profiles will ensure variety and keep everyone engaged.
A delicious and colorful plate of chicken, sweet potatoes, and green beans, representing a balanced meal.
Effortless weeknight dinners are achievable with a solid plan.

Step 4: Build Your Comprehensive Shopping List

With your recipes chosen, create a detailed shopping list. Group items by category (produce, dairy, meat, pantry staples) to make your trip efficient. Double-check your pantry again as you write your list to avoid buying duplicates. A precise list is your best friend against impulse purchases.

Step 5: Schedule Your Meals (and Flexibility!)

Assign each meal to a specific day of the week. However, build in flexibility. If Tuesday turns out to be unexpectedly busy, swap your elaborate meal for a quicker one planned for Thursday. Life happens, and your meal plan should adapt. Remember these important considerations:

  • Don’t Forget Leftover Nights: Strategically plan for leftover nights. If you cook a large batch of chili on Monday, plan to enjoy the leftovers on Tuesday. This further reduces waste and provides an effortless meal.
  • Account for Dining Out: If you know you’ll be dining out or ordering in one night, factor that into your plan. This prevents over-purchasing groceries and ensures your fridge isn’t overflowing with food you won’t get to.
  • Batch Cooking & Meal Prep: Consider spending an hour or two on the weekend doing some light meal prep. Chopping vegetables, cooking grains, or marinating meats in advance can significantly speed up weeknight cooking.

Unleash Your Inner Chef: Tips for Successful Meal Planning

Beyond the basic steps, a few extra tips can elevate your meal planning game and ensure long-term success:

  • Start Small: If you’re new to meal planning, don’t try to plan every single meal from scratch. Begin by planning dinners only, or even just three dinners a week, and gradually increase as you get comfortable.
  • Involve the Family: Let everyone contribute ideas for meals. This increases excitement and ensures there’s something everyone enjoys, making the plan more likely to succeed.
  • Prep Ahead: Utilize those quiet moments. Chop vegetables on Sunday, pre-portion snacks, or marinate meat a day in advance. These small steps make a big difference on busy weeknights.
  • Be Flexible, Not Rigid: Your meal plan is a guide, not a strict dictator. If an ingredient goes bad, or you simply crave something else, it’s okay to pivot. The goal is stress reduction, not perfection.
  • Explore Resources: Don’t reinvent the wheel! Look for inspiration from food blogs, cookbooks, and video channels.
